Summary

Paris Saint-Germain has decided against pursuing Bayern Munich winger Michael Olise, citing the complexity of a potential deal. The club looks to refresh its squad and is now focusing on other targets, including Monaco's Maghnes Akliouche and RB Leipzig’s Yan Diomande. Olise himself is pushing for a move to Real Madrid and has spoken to teammates about the transition. Meanwhile, Bayern remains firm on keeping Olise, who has expressed his desire for a switch but is under contract until 2029. His future is expected to clarify after the FIFA World Cup, where he has excelled with five assists.
